Wen Wu is a celebrated Chinese artist based in London, whose portraits resonate with emotional depth and poetic grace. Born in Qingdao in 1978, she studied at Tsinghua University under the renowned Chen Dan Qing, one of China’s most influential art educators. Wu has forged a distinct path, grounded in a refined, neo-realist style that bridges East and West. Inspired by 19th-century French plein air romanticism, literature, the English Pre-Raphaelites, and the School of Paris, her work is rich with shadow, colour, and nuance. Though deeply figurative, her paintings possess an almost sacred abstraction. A devoted bibliophile, she draws from literature—curating titles from Nabokov to Sade—infusing her work with narrative and symbolism. Her art has been exhibited in leading museums across London, Beijing, Seoul, and Taipei, including the National Portrait Gallery and the Saatchi Gallery. Awarded the prestigious Portrait Award, Wen Wu’s work invites quiet reflection—where beauty, intellect, and emotion meet.

AI & Technology Influence on Contemporary Art
The "AI & Technology Influence on Contemporary Art" exhibition explores the impact of technology on contemporary artists, revealing how AI has shaped and challenged their creative processes while sparking profound dialogues on its implications. In “AI & Technology Influence on Contemporary Art," artists Jonathan Yeo, Von Wolfe, and Henry Hudson have embraced AI and technology to redefine the essence of a new series of works, seamlessly integrating artificial intelligence and cutting-edge technologies. Through these groundbreaking works, they explore and masterly navigate the complex relationship between humanity and machines, prompting a re-evaluation of art's future, probing the boundaries of AI's capacity to expand or limit artistic expression, extending to questions of identity, development, authorship, authenticity, originality, reality, and the evolving landscape of creativity in the digital age.
